1. Why AI Search Changes the Game
1.1 From keywords to intent & entities
Modern AI search systems reason with entities and contexts, not isolated keywords. Entities let models connect user intent to structured knowledge so your page must map clearly to recognized concepts rather than merely stuffing phrases.
1.2 Recommendations over lists
AI-driven interfaces increasingly return curated answers or recommended resources instead of ranked blue links. This changes the click model: being “recommended” can replace being #1. That’s why brands must design for recommendation slots—structured data, clear provenance, and trust signals.
1.3 Voice assistants and multi-modal discovery
Search is multi-modal: text, voice, image, and conversational assistants. Voice answers favor authoritative, concise, and well-structured sources—organizations that align with these characteristics get recommended more often.
2. Core Trust Signals AI Search Prioritizes
2.1 Provenance and authoritativeness
AI models surface sources based on signals they can tie back to reliable originators: author credentials, publication history, and corroboration. Building author pages, bios, and citation networks makes you easier to verify.
2.2 Structured data and entity markup
Machine-readable structures (JSON-LD, schema.org) help AI systems map your content to entities. This is not optional anymore; it's a baseline. Include clear organizationSchema, author, product, and review markups when applicable.
2.3 User engagement and behavioral evidence
Signals like long clicks, low pogo-sticking, and repeat visitation now feed ML-based heuristics. Optimize UX and content clarity to improve these behavioral metrics—speed and clarity convert into trust.
3. Content Strategy: From E-E-A-T to Recommendation-Ready Assets
3.1 Reinterpreting E-E-A-T for AI recommendation
Experience, Expertise, Authoritativeness, and Trustworthiness (E-E-A-T) remain relevant but must map to AI-readable cues: verified author identities, citations, structured data, and consistent publishing signals. Build content clusters around entities with cross-linking to authoritative resources.
3.2 Content formats AI favors
AI systems prefer concise answers and richly structured explanation layers: short answer snippets followed by expandable, evidence-backed sections. Think modular content that provides both a single-sentence answer and linked in-depth sections for verification.

5. Recommendation Strategies: How to Win More AI Suggestions
5.1 Optimization for snippet & card formats
Design content blocks that answer common queries precisely and include verification links. Use short lead-ins followed by evidence, and test phrasing with conversational prompts to improve how AI extracts answers.
5.2 Signals that increase recommendation weight
Prioritize: structured data, reliable citations, author/organization trust pages, site performance, and positive user feedback loops. These combine to make your content a high-confidence candidate for recommendation.

6. PPC Methods and Paid Media in an AI Search World
6.1 Rethinking keywords to intent signals
PPC still matters but the targeting model shifts to intents and entity audiences. Build audiences around entities (brand mentions, product families) and optimize bids for recommendation conversion rate rather than click position alone.
6.2 Creative testing for recommendation compatibility

6.3 Attribution and shifting conversion touchpoints
Recommendation slots and voice answers create discovery without predictable clicks. Use first-party measurement, enhanced conversions, and server-side event collection to trace downstream conversions. Pair these with careful experimental setups.
7. Measurement, Attribution & Campaign Optimization
7.1 Metrics that matter in AI-first discovery
Traditional ranking metrics are complemented by recommendation rate, short-answer prevalence, and trust audits. Define KPIs such as 'AI recommendation share' and 'provenance click-through rate' to capture these effects.
7.2 Decision frameworks under uncertainty
Because AI systems are evolving, adopt robust decision-making. Use scenario planning, A/B test guardrails, and rapid iteration. 7.3 Building an experiment pipeline for recommendation outcomes
Run hybrid experiments: content variants, schema inclusion, author verification, and UX changes. Measure not only immediate click lifts but downstream conversion rate and repeat visitation—these are stronger signals of trust to AI systems.

10. Implementation Roadmap: 90-Day Plan
10.1 Days 0–30: Audit & quick wins
Run an audit focusing on schema coverage, top landing pages, author identity pages, page speed, and critical UX flows. Apply schema to high-traffic entity pages and publish clear author bios. Begin short ad creative tests aligned with AI snippets.
10.2 Days 31–60: Experiments & measurement
Run controlled experiments: schema addition, summary block variants, and author pages. Measure recommendation rate and downstream conversions. Use server-side tagging and enhanced conversions for attribution resilience.
10.3 Days 61–90: Scale and governance
Roll successful changes sitewide, create governance docs, and automate schema injection in CMS templates. Train teams on responding to AI-driven discovery changes and define a quarterly review cadence.
Pro Tip: Prioritize verifying top 20% of pages producing 80% of conversions. A small set of high-value pages yields the largest lift in recommendation rate when optimized for provenance and schema.
11. Comparison: Trust Signals — Impact & Prioritization
The table below helps you prioritize engineering and editorial effort by signal impact and complexity.
| Trust Signal | Why it matters for AI search | Implementation steps | Priority (1–5) |
|---|---|---|---|
| Structured data & entity markup | Enables precise mapping to knowledge graphs and excerpts | Add JSON-LD for organization, author, product, and FAQ; test with Rich Results Validator | 5 |
| Author / provenance pages | Helps model verify expertise and experience | Create persistent author profiles, link to social/ORCID where possible | 4 |
| User engagement metrics | Signals real-world usefulness to ML models | Improve page UX, reduce bounce, add next-step CTAs | 4 |
| Third-party reviews & ratings | External corroboration boosts trust | Aggregate reviews, publish review schema, display provenance | 3 |
| Security & site performance | Operational trust—fast secure sites are preferred | Use HTTPS, optimize Core Web Vitals, reduce payloads | 4 |

13. FAQs: Quick Answers and Technical How-Tos
What is the single most important change for SEO in an AI search world?
Move from isolated keywords to entity and provenance-first content. Provide structured data and clear author provenance so the AI can verify and recommend your content reliably.
How should PPC budgets change with AI recommendations?
Shift a portion of budget to audience signals and entity-based targeting; prioritize creatives optimized for short answers and measure downstream conversion lifts, not just CTR.

How do I measure whether I'm being recommended more often?
Create custom metrics: detect downstream referral traffic from known AI properties, track changes in direct snippet clicks, and set up experiments that toggle schema or provenance elements to measure impact.
